One thing that always amazed me when I played sports (swimming and tennis) was how practice and taking care of myself helped a lot. I could feel the difference if I didn’t eat right the day before a swim meet, or if I had neglected to exercise in the days prior to a tennis match.
The same concept holds true in personal finance as well. You need to practice good finance habits (paying off credit cards ASAP, avoiding a great deal of debt, disciplined saving and investing) as well as take care of your financial health regularly.
